Campaign North Star Session
Distill a single north-star sentence and guardrails that every channel brief inherits.

Inside the session
Teams that split into channel silos learn to forge a parent brief element that travels. You stress-test the north star against three real channel constraints from your portfolio.
What we practice
- North star stress matrix
- Channel inheritance worksheet
- Breakout for social, retail, and CRM examples
- Guardrail phrases that prevent scope creep
- Live vote on language variants
- Sign-off ritual for leadership
- Poster export for studio walls
Artifacts you leave with
- Parent brief element with three inherited child briefs drafted
- Guardrail list agreed by channel leads
- Poster-ready sentence for studio visibility

Logistics questions
We include a module on English master briefs with local market addenda.
You practice facilitated tie-break language—no forced consensus theater.
Media buying tactics are out of scope; this is brief architecture only.
